How to fill out clinical forensic neuroscience-informed practitioner

How to fill out clinical forensic neuroscience-informed practitioner
01
Step 1: Obtain the necessary educational background in neuroscience and psychology, such as obtaining a bachelor's degree in neuroscience or psychology.
02
Step 2: Apply for and complete a specialized training program in clinical forensic neuroscience, which may include coursework and practical experience in areas such as neuroscience research, clinical assessments, forensic psychology, and legal elements of forensic evaluation.
03
Step 3: Obtain relevant certifications or licenses, such as becoming a licensed psychologist or licensed clinical social worker, depending on the specific requirements of the jurisdiction.
04
Step 4: Continuously update and expand knowledge and skills through attending conferences, workshops, and relevant research studies in the field of clinical forensic neuroscience.
05
Step 5: Develop professional relationships with other practitioners and organizations working in the field to stay updated on the latest research, techniques, and best practices.
06
Step 6: Adhere to ethical guidelines and standards while providing clinical forensic neuroscience-informed assessments and treatments, ensuring the well-being and safety of the clients.
07
Step 7: Maintain accurate and detailed records of assessments, treatments, and consultations, while prioritizing confidentiality and privacy of the clients' information.

What is clinical forensic neuroscience-informed practitioner?
A clinical forensic neuroscience-informed practitioner is a professional who integrates knowledge of neuroscience with clinical forensic practices to provide insights or evaluations in legal contexts, often focusing on the intersection of mental health and the law.
